What are the most important historical sites and other places in Machu Picchu?
Machu Picchu is notable for landmarks like Temple of the Condor, Temple of the Sun and Royal Tomb. The hiking trails and mountain views highlight the natural beauty with places to discover including Aguas Calientes Hot Springs, Huayna Picchu and Inca Trail. A couple of additional sights to add to your itinerary are Central Plaza and Intipunku.
What is a historic hotel like in Machu Picchu?
Guests who choose historic hotels have the chance to stay in a place officially recognised with a national historic designation. Historic hotels throughout the world can be castles, palaces or even pubs or old police stations — as long as it’s of special interest. These types of hotels in Machu Picchu usually retain original qualities like traditional architecture and period features in their communal spaces or guestrooms.
What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
These are quite similar. “Historic hotel” is a term often used in the US, while you’ll often hear “heritage hotel” in Asia and Europe. Historic hotels tend to place more significance on the architecture and actual building. Mainly heritage hotels draw meaning from the cultural value and how it inspired the community.
